I can not say I am totally shocked, but I am a bit shocked it happened now. Tons of news on Google Buying a Radio Ad company, Google Agrees to Buy dMarc Extending Its Reach Into Radio (WSJ).

We got AdWords (PPC), we got AdSense (Publisher ads), we got AdPrint (Paper ads) and now we got AdVoice (radio ads). Mike Grehan believes TV is on the way, and I see no reason to argue with that. We also have Danny & Gary at SEW on the topic and Andy Beal where I found the news first.
